Quick Answer
Low-intensity burns, even those that don't fully clear vegetation, can still benefit quail populations by stimulating new growth, reducing dense underbrush, and creating habitat diversity.
Controlled Burns and Quail Habitat
Prescribed burning is a widely accepted technique for maintaining and enhancing wildlife habitats. For quail and grouse, low-intensity burns can be particularly beneficial. These burns don’t need to be intense to be effective; rather, they should be designed to stimulate new growth and reduce dense underbrush. By doing so, they create a mosaic of different habitat types, providing quail with the food, shelter, and breeding grounds they need.
Burn Intensity and Quail Benefit
The key to a successful low-intensity burn for quail is to maintain a moderate temperature, typically around 300-400°F (150-200°C), for a short period. This can be achieved through careful planning, including the timing of the burn, the choice of fuels, and the use of firebreaks. By doing so, the burn will stimulate new growth and reduce dense underbrush without causing excessive damage to the vegetation.
Regrowth and Quail Habitat Diversity
After a low-intensity burn, the area will undergo a process of regrowth, which can be a critical phase for quail habitat diversity. During this time, new plants will emerge, and the existing vegetation will grow back. By controlling the burn intensity and timing, it’s possible to create a diverse range of habitat types, including grasslands, shrublands, and woodlands. This diversity is essential for quail, as it provides them with the food, shelter, and breeding grounds they need to thrive.
